8th Wonder Unveils Lineup For Inaugural Rotorua Festival

8th Wonder – a new boutique festival of Sound & Culture – is set to make its debut in Rotorua this January, with the lineup confirmed for the debut installment.
Launching in Rotorua and Brisbane, 8th Wonder is a new one-day festival bringing together leading artists from across Aotearoa, Australia and the wider Pacific. Built around reggae, roots, soul, dub, R&B, and contemporary Indigenous sounds, 8th Wonder is designed as a celebration of music, culture, place and connection.

8th Wonder will take place at the Village Green in Rotorua, on the shores of Lake Rotorua. Located at the feet of Eat Street in the centre of Rotorua, 8th Wonder will showcase the incredible destination alongside some of the best music from Aotearoa and beyond.
8th Wonder Brisbane will take place at the newly expanded Eatons Hill Outdoor Precinct, a spectacular new festival destination set amongst towering trees on the former Eatons Hill Golf Course, just north of Brisbane. Spanning 14 hectares, it provides the perfect backdrop for world-class music in one of Queensland’s most exciting entertainment venues.
The all-ages event (Under 18’s to be accompanied by parent or legal guardian) will provide an opportunity for everyone to enjoy the power of live music, and embrace the elements of our culture that make Rotorua truly one-of-a-kind. Under 5s free with a paying adult.
With more hotel nights than any regional destination in New Zealand and a vision of becoming an entirely bilingual city, Rotorua is the perfect home for 8th Wonder. The festival aims to celebrate te ao Māori, showcase the region’s unique identity and create a welcoming experience for everyone.

Supported by RotoruaNZ, 8th Wonder comes from Loop, the team behind music, culture, festivals and live shows across Australasia for more than 20 years. 8th Wonder is being created with the goal of continuing on the ethos started with the first Loop compilations from the early 2000’s – taking the best music from Aotearoa to the world.
